On Wed 10-08-11 17:12:40, Michal Marek wrote:
> Introduced in 3.1-rc1, IS_ENABLED(CONFIG_NUMA) expands to a true value
> iff CONFIG_NUMA is set. This makes it easier to grep for code that
> depends on CONFIG_NUMA.

It looks this doesn't work properly. I can see the following build
error:
CHK include/linux/version.h
CHK include/generated/utsrelease.h
UPD include/generated/utsrelease.h
CC arch/x86/kernel/asm-offsets.s
In file included from include/linux/kmod.h:22:0,
from include/linux/module.h:13,
from include/linux/crypto.h:21,
from arch/x86/kernel/asm-offsets.c:8:
include/linux/gfp.h: In function âgfp_zonelistâ:
include/linux/gfp.h:265:1: error: â__enabled_CONFIG_NUMAâ undeclared (first use in this function)
include/linux/gfp.h:265:1: note: each undeclared identifier is reported only once for each function it appears in
include/linux/gfp.h:265:1: error: â__enabled_CONFIG_NUMA_MODULEâ undeclared (first use in this function)
make[1]: *** [arch/x86/kernel/asm-offsets.s] Error 1

I do not have CONFIG_NUMA set so it seems to have issues with config
symbols which are not set to any value. Is this something that could be
fixed?
